It’s time to throw out the old rulebook...
The sales world has been built around masculine strategies - push harder, hustle more, close at all costs. But here’s the truth: that approach doesn’t work for women… and it’s burning you out.
In this powerful conversation with Feminine Sales Coach Riley May, we break down why women are not meant to sell like men, and how embracing your feminine strengths can actually make you magnetic in business.
Inside this episode, we cover:
โจ Why traditional sales tactics feel “icky” for women (and what to do instead)
โจ The secret power of feminine energy in building connection & trust
โจ How to shift from force into flow while still hitting big sales goals
โจ The confidence reframe that changes the way you sell forever
If you’ve ever felt like selling wasn’t for you, or it's 'cringey' this episode will flip the script. Your natural gifts as a woman aren’t a weakness in sales, they’re your ultimate superpower.
